When I went out to start my morning run today, a butterfly was flying around me. I held out my finger and it flutter onto it. I’ve had weirder stuff happen to me in my life, but this was kinda neat. A bit of wind piped up and blew the butterfly off its perch. I saw it flutter away but not too far. I was thinking to myself, wow that was kinda cool, when it flutters back onto my index finger which I still held out. I turned my back into the breeze that was blowing from the northeast so the little critter wouldn’t get blown off again. I held out my finger for a mighty long spell as we both looked at each other. How fascinating to have this tiny “quantum mind” sitting in awe of me as I was in awe of it. When we were both done, I walked it over to a creosote bush where I let it walk off unto a small branch with little yellow flowers.
